*** *** *** *** D-3 INFO *** *** *** ***

As some of you may know from reading my previous newsletters, there's a new type of Digivice game in Japan called the D-3. In it you get two Digimon, V-mon and Wormmon.

While the main focus of the D-3 is armor evolution, the newest issue of V Jump has revealed how you can make your Wormmon and V-mon evolve naturally!

Once you've collected the Digimentals of Courage, Friendship, Love, and Reliability, Wormmon can evolve to Stingmon and V-mon can evolve to XV-mon.

Then using Jogress evolution, they can fuse together to form their Ultimate stages, Paildramon for V-mon and Dino Beemon for Wormmon!

If you have a WonderSwan in addition to the D-3, you can make them evolve to Mega!! You need the newest WonderSwan game, Tag Tamers. By hooking up the D-3 to the WonderSwan and using the Metal Greymon from that game, Paildramon can fuse with him to form Imperial Dramon! In the same way, Dino Beemon can fuse with a Mega Kabuterimon from that game to form Gran Kuwagamon!

** *** *** *** D-3 INFO *** *** *** ***

Well, it's official! A new version of the D-3 will be released in late September and will be called D-3 Version 2. This new version will feature Tailmon (Gatomon) and Hawkmon. Although the first version of the D-3 came in two colors, black and blue/white, this new D-3 will only come in red/white.

As in the first version, you'll be able to collect the eight normal Digimentals (Courage, Friendship, Sincerity, Love, Reliability, Knowledge, Light, and Hope) in order to armor evolve to 8 different new forms! That means coming soon we'll be seeing more cool armor evolutions for Tailmon and Hawkmon. Look to my newsletter for scans from V Jump (hopefully the November issue will have some pics) and from the new series of cards (that's right, a new Booster 7 and Starter 4 will be out in mid October in Japan!). 

In addition to the original 8 Digimentals, in the current version of the D-3, the Digimentals of Miracles and Kindness are also available. As I revealed in my last issue, in order to get the Digmental of Miracles, you need the D-Terminal. The same goes for the Digimental of Kindness. It is unknown whether these two Digimentals will also be available in the new D-3 or whether there will be new Digimentals.

It is expected that you will only be able to evolve to Mega by linking with the WonderSwan game, Tag Tamers, but so far it is unknown which Digimon you will need to Jogress with.

Last month I revealed that the D-Terminal was necessary to find the Digimental of Miracles. If you have a D-Terminal, you can use the following steps to make the Digimentals of Miracles and Kindness.

Kindness: combine the Digimentals of Courage, Friendship, and Light
Miracles: combine the Digimentals of Sincerity, Hope, and Kindness

*** *** *** *** NEW D-3 INFO *** *** *** ***

As I stated last month, there is a new D-3 out in Japan. This one features Hawkmon's and Tailmon's evolution. I don't have any pics of Tailmon's evolutions, but I do have pics of all of Hawkmon's armored forms.

Of course you all know his evolution with the Digimental of Love, Holsmon, and with the Digimental of Sincerity, Shurimon. But now you can see pics of his other 8 forms, too!

Knowledge- Flybeemon
Friendship- Rinkmon
Reliability- Orcamon
Hope- Moosemon
Courage- Allomon
Light- Harpymon
Miracles- Peacockmon
Kindness- Toucanmon

Not only is there a new D-3 in Japan, but a D-3 has been released in the US, too! I'm not clear on all the details as I don't own one myself, but here's what I've heard.

This D-3 comes in various colors, perhaps all the colors of the DigiDestineds' D-3s. Instead of having one D-3 with a couple Digimon in it, the US version lets you start with Hawkmon, Veemon, Armadillomon, Gatomon, and Patamon. Later on you'll also gain Wormmon. On the down side, you can only use the same Digimentals on the Digimon as are used in the show. So the only Digimon who can equip Courage is V-mon, etc. You won't get to see all the cool evolutions from the Japanese version. However, after certain points in the game, you will be able to evolve to Champion, Ultimate, and Mega.

The price for the US D-3 is $13.99 and you can find it at Toys R Us and other stores.


*** *** *** *** D-3 NEWS *** *** *** ***

There are two new D-3s coming out in Japan. The first is D-3 V-mon Version Limited Edition. This is the same as the original D-3 featuring Wormmon and V-mon except for two things. The coloring is different and the bosses and enemies are different. I've scanned a picture for you to see, but the colors are really cool. The main body is clear plastic with black accents and the grips on the sides are blue. The enemies you'll fight are Volcamon (a Digimon from a Japanese promo battle card, he was based on the man who hosts the D-1 card tournaments, Volcano Oota), Anteiramon, Cherubimon, Archnemon, Mummymon, and Rapidmon. In addition to all that, you'll also be able to evolve to Imperial Dramon Fighter Mode, the upright humanoid form of Imperial Dramon. There will be more info in the February issue of V Jump (and the January issue of the newsletter!).

The next new D-3 is the long awaited D-3 Version 3, featuring Armadimon and patamon. There are two color choices, black/blue or white/yellow. More information will be available next month!
